Rumford select board approves liquor licenses, service agreement and groundwater permit

Town of Rumford Board of Select Persons · January 2, 2025

At its Jan. 2 meeting the Rumford Board of Select Persons approved a liquor license and special amusement permit for The Lure Restaurant & Seahorse Lounge, approved Warrant #27, a service level agreement with the Northern Oxford Solid Waste Board, an order permitting large-scale groundwater extraction for the Rumford Water District, and extended the Hotel Rumford liquor license to Jan. 23. Several items were unanimously approved 4-0.

The Rumford Board of Select Persons voted on multiple routine and regulatory items at its Jan. 2 meeting in the Rumford Falls Auditorium.

The board approved a liquor license and a special amusement permit for The Lure Restaurant & Seahorse Lounge, whose applicant was identified as Deirdra Gallant. Select Board member Theriault moved to approve the license and permit; Select Board member DiConzo seconded and the motion carried 4-0.

The board unanimously approved Warrant #27 (motion by Select Board member DiConzo; second Theriault).

The board approved an added agenda item, a Service Level Agreement between the Town of Rumford and the Northern Oxford Solid Waste Board. Select Board member Brennick moved approval; Select Board member Theriault seconded and the vote was 4-0.

The board approved an order permitting the Rumford Water District to conduct large-scale groundwater extraction (motion by DiConzo; second Theriault; vote 4-0). The transcript records the board's approval but does not specify technical terms, limits, or conditions of the extraction order; those details were not specified in the minutes.

The board also approved an extension for the Hotel Rumford's liquor license through Jan. 23 (motion by Brennick; second DiConzo; vote 4-0).

The meeting concluded after the board entered executive session on personnel matters under 1 M.R.S. §405(6)(A) at 6:47 p.m. and exited at 8:24 p.m.; the board adjourned at 8:25 p.m.

What happens next: Several approvals were recorded as unanimous 4-0 votes. The minutes indicate further consideration of several items — including the extension date for the Hotel Rumford license and a tabled environmental concern — at the board's rescheduled Jan. 23 meeting.
